Lightning Labs Wants to 'Bitcoinize the Dollar' with Stablecoins

Lightning Labs, one of the major firms responsible for developing Bitcoin’s lightning network, has released the mainnet alpha of its long-awaited “Taproot Assets” protocol on Wednesday, allowing stablecoins and other tokens to functionally trade on Bitcoin.

In its Wednesday announcement, the firm touted its release as “the dawn of a new era for bitcoin,” effectively transforming it into a “global routing network for the internet of money.”

“We believe this new era for bitcoin will see a myriad of global currencies issued as Taproot Assets, and the world's foreign exchange transactions settled instantly over the Lightning Network,” wrote Ryan Gentry, Lightning Labs’ Director of Business Development.

Formerly known as “Taro,” Taproot Assets leverages Bitcoin’s “Taproot” upgrade from 2021, which bolstered the network’s smart contract capabilities while improving the privacy and memory efficiency of transactions.
